Grazing

Grazing

Roe deer (Capreolus capreolus) finding something to eat under the snow. Guess they stay in the sun to get some warmth in the cold weather. This little deer weighs around 20 to 30 kilos. Cute, but their large numbers creates lots of damage in gardens and for farmers. They are also involved in a large number of traffic accidents.
